Yorkies are little in size however big in personality. They typically weigh in between 4 to 7 pounds and stand about 7 to 8 inches tall. Understood for their long, smooth coats, they can be a spectacular addition to any household. Yorkies are smart, affectionate, and can be remarkably perky, making them a great companion for both people and families.

Common Health Issues in Yorkies
While Yorkies are generally healthy, like all types, they are vulnerable to particular health problems. Being informed can assist you make the best decisions for your puppy’s wellness.
Health IssueDescriptionPatellar LuxationA condition where the kneecap dislocates, causing discomfort and mobility problems.Hip DysplasiaA hereditary condition impacting the hip joint, leading to arthritis.Oral IssuesYorkies are vulnerable to dental issues; regular oral care is essential.HypoglycemiaLow blood sugar levels can occur, especially in little breeds; monitor their eating practices.Collapsed TracheaA breathing condition that may require veterinary intervention.6. FAQ
Q: How much do Yorkie puppies cost?A: The price can vary based on factors like pedigree, area, and breeder reputation. Generally, expect to pay in between 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 3,000.

Q: Can Yorkies be left alone?A: Yorkies do not like being left alone for prolonged durations. They grow on friendship and can experience separation stress and anxiety. Q: How often do Yorkies require grooming?A: Yorkies require routine grooming-- preferably every 4-6 weeks. Daily brushing is likewise suggested to avoid matting.
